Output acaa270bf39d40e6cf4c9c22e257209a46d6ddabc45659753043f6b037606334:0

value
598674
script pubkey
OP_0 OP_PUSHBYTES_20 43b58cc10fb4d79ca4515868f2a2fad25830ae5b
address
bc1qgw6cesg0knteefz3tp509gh66fvrptjmj59gdy
transaction
acaa270bf39d40e6cf4c9c22e257209a46d6ddabc45659753043f6b037606334
spent
true